WebHere's how to calculate sales tax by hand: Subtract the listed item price from the total price you paid. (Example: Total price $545.00 - listed price $500 = $45) Then, divide the difference amount ($45) by the listed price. (Example: $45 / $500 = 0.09) Finally, multiply that number by 100. This converts it to the actual percentage rate of the ... Improve accuracy with rates based on address quotes from as good as it gets the movieWebThe statewide tax rate is 7.25%. In most areas of California, local jurisdictions have added district taxes that increase the tax owed by a seller. Those district tax rates range from 0.10% to 1.00%.
